Output abde60bc1e5ff2ce7958a1a7eff69f74522fae0261d017649fafaa850fedcfc0:1

value
664902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001b0a5841400b2befc8f8b5a21159bf0ba19638 OP_EQUAL
address
31haKLvYdBoe1rCEZheFHyRYPx3WzxZzVC
transaction
abde60bc1e5ff2ce7958a1a7eff69f74522fae0261d017649fafaa850fedcfc0